French fashion house Louis Vuitton, was crowned the world's most valuable luxury brand for the seventh consecutive year!
According to Millward Brown Optimor's BrandZ study, the LVMH Moet Hennessy Louis Vuitton-owned label's worth increased 7% since 2011 to $25.9 billion.

Karl Lagerfeld presented his Chanel Cruise collection in the gardens of Versailles on Monday.
The 2012/2013 line is obviously inspired by the 1700s and Marie Antoinette, just don't tell Karl that.
He said of his designs:
"It’s serious revolt. It’s not at all 18th century. It’s very rock. You can hardly recognize the girls."
